Latest Patents

Wen Ji holds a patent for a "Scalable Visual Computing System." This system includes a front-end device, an edge service, and a cloud service that are interconnected. The front-end device is designed to output compressed video data and feature data. The edge service is responsible for storing the video data and converging the feature data, while also transmitting various types of data and control commands. The cloud service stores algorithm models that support various applications and returns a model stream based on model query commands. This architecture enables parallel data transmission of video streams, feature streams, and model streams, facilitating collaboration between end, edge, and cloud services.
